We encourage our customers to assist us as much as possible by taking the following additional steps while on property:
- Leave the Pins in the Hole throughout your round of Golf (We say 3 feet and in is good)!
- Water Coolers have been removed from the golf course, you can purchase bottle water from the Golf Shop or Beverage Cart
- Bunker Rakes have been removed from all bunkers, please use your feet to smooth out footprints. FREE Placement in Bunkers!
- Practice “Social Distancing”, meaning:
- Take turns riding in a Golf Cart or walk the golf course, Moon Valley is an easy course to walk and it is a great way to get some exercise!
